Save the Date! Building No Kill Communities Workshop Scheduled for the Evening of April 16 in Douglasville, GA


Save the date! The 'Building No Kill Communities' workshop featuring Nathan Winograd has been scheduled for the evening of Friday April 16, 2010 in Douglasville, GA. Douglasville is conveniently located off I-20 just West of Atlanta. The event will be free and open to the public, but you will need to sign up in advance. Details about how to do that will be available soon. The event is sponsored by the Carroll County Humane Society, which will be selling signed copies of Nathan's books to offset the costs of putting on the workshop. Details about ordering your copies will be available soon as well.

Rescuers, members of humane groups, shelter directors and employees, animal control officers, city and county officials and animal lovers are all encouraged to attend. The workshop has been described as “a prerequisite for animal lovers, rescue groups and organizations that are serious about changing their communities to No Kill.”

Georgia kills way too many animals in its shelters. Georgia can and will be No Kill. You can be part of this sea change.

Atlanta Animal Welfare Examiner

In addition to this blog, I am writing for the Examiner, as the Atlanta Animal Welfare Examiner. I will be covering animal welfare issues in the Atlanta metro area and Georgia in general from a No Kill perspective. I will also announce local animal welfare-related events and feature one or more adoptable pet per week. Have a story idea, event or pet you'd like to see featured? Send me an email.
